Long time ago Banyuwangi was
called Blambangan. It was a kingdom under a wise king who had a handsome and
smart son. Raden Banterang was his name. He liked hunting very much. He often
went to forest around Blambangan to hunt for animals. One day when he was in a
forest he saw a deer. He chased it and the deer ran deeper into the forest. His
horse was so good and strong that he left his guards behind. Unfortunately he
lost the deer. As he took a rest under a big banyan tree suddenly a lovely lady
appeared in front of him. Raden Banterang was very surprised to see a beautiful
girl alone in the forest. He was suspicious that she was not a human being.So he
asked her.
‘Excuse me lovely lady, do you live around here?’
‘No, I don’t. I’m from Klungkung, Bali. My name
is Surati. I’m a princess, the daughter of the king of Klungkung. I need your
help’
‘I will gladly help you, but please tell me what
your problem is’
‘I’m in danger. There was a rebellion in
Klungkung. The rebel killed my father but I could escape. My guards took me
here but I lose them. Now I’m alone. I don’t know where to go. I have no
relative here. Please help me’
‘You are coming to the right person. I’m prince
Banterang from the kingdom of Blambangan. I will protect you. Please come with
me.’
Then Raden Banterang took Surati home. He fell in
love with her and then several months later he married her. One day when Surati
was in the street he met a man. The man called him.
‘Surati, Surati’
She was surprised to realize
that the man was her brother Rupaksa. Rupaksa told her that it was Raden
Banterang who killed their father. He came to Blambangan to take revenge and
asked surati to join him. Surati was shocked but she refused to join.
‘I’m really shocked to hear the news. But I’m not sure. Raden Banterang is now
my husband. He’s very kind to me. He never hurts me. He’s protecting me. As a
good wife I will never betray him. It is my duty to serve him.’
‘But he killed our father’.
‘It is hard for me to believe
it. When I met him he was here, not in Klungkung’
Rupaksa was disappointed with her sister. He was also very angry to her.
‘OK then. I have to go now. But please keep my head dress. Put it under your
pillow’
Rupaksa gave his head dress to his sister Surati. To respect her older brother
Surati put it under her pillow. Several days later Raden Banterang was hunting
in a forest when he met a man that looked like a priest. The man greeted him
politely. Then he said something.
‘Your life is in danger. Someone has an evil intention to you’
‘Who is he?’
“Your wife Surati’
“Surati? How do you know?’
‘I am a priest. I have clear spiritual vision. I
just want to save you. Search her room. If you find a head dress under her
pillow then my words are correct. It is from a man who will help her kill you’
‘Thank you your Holiness’
Raden Banterang was shocked.
He was very angry to his wife then he immediately went home. When he got to the
palace he immediately searched Surati’s bed room. As he found the head dress
under her pillow he was sure that the priest was right.
‘You are unfaithful wife. I know that you want me dead. This is the evidence.
This is from a man who will help you kill me. Tell me who he is’
Surati was shocked and cried.
‘It is my brother’s head
dress. I met him several days ago when you went hunting. He gave me his
head dress and told me to put it under my pillow. So I put it there to respect
him. It is him who want to kill you, not me’
But Raden Banterang did not
trust her. He gave her a death sentence. He took his wife to a river bank as he
would stab his wife and throw her body into the river.
‘Before I die, let me say a few words’
‘Please do’
‘After I die, just throw my body into the river.
If the water become dirty and smelly, it means that I am guilty. But if the
water become clear and fragrance come out of it, it means that I am innocence’.
Then as Raden Banterang would
stab her wife with a kris Surati threw herself into the river. Amazingly the
water became clear and fragrance came out of it. Surati was innocent! Raden
Banterang regretted his emotional behavior. Since then on he changed the name
of his kingdom into Banyuwangi. Banyu means water and Wangi means fragrance.
